Samson Klugman's Quality Capital and Leo Tsimmers Caerus Group just purchased two East Village buildings that once housed the Parisian-style club La Belle Epoque for $60M. 827-829 and 831 Broadway (pictured) belonged to designer Howard Kaplan for 35 years before the off-market deal, The Real Deal reports. Together the buildings cover 36.5k SF, with another 30k SF of air rights, 75 feet of frontage on Broadway, and a bit more on East 12th Street. Each building has two floors of retail and two floors of rentals. The main draw for the buyers was the 10k SF of prime retail space on Broadway right by Union Square, though no plans for the property were disclosed. [TRD]
